eMAG Genius program marks first anniversary with 1 billion HUF in savings for shoppers

eMAG Genius subscription-based loyalty program has marked its first anniversary in Hungary. Over the past year, customers of eMAG and Fashion Days have collectively saved more than 1 billion forints through the program’s discounts and free delivery options.

Starting July 1, 2025, eMAG Genius members can access free delivery and Wolt+ benefits within the Wolt app by logging in with their eMAG credentials. This integration allows users to manage their Genius dashboard directly from the Wolt app.

Rejoy.hu, known for its refurbished mobile devices and consoles, has also joined the Genius program. This collaboration offers Genius subscribers exclusive promotions, free delivery, and free parcel locker pickups for Rejoy.hu orders.

Significant savings and regional growth

The eMAG Genius program has proven to be a significant cost-saver for its users. On average, a typical Hungarian customer saves about 12,000 forints annually on logistics costs through the program. The service is widely utilized not only in Budapest but also in other major cities like Debrecen, Szeged, Miskolc, and Győr.

Launched initially in Romania in 2020, the eMAG Genius program has expanded across the region, amassing over 1.5 million users. In Hungary, the program is available for an annual fee of 4,990 forints.
